49ersfan Posted December 31, 2019 Share Posted December 31, 2019 (edited) 49ers have had so many key big plays this year. Matt Breidá's 83 yard opening play TD run against the Browns on MNF week 5, Emmanuel Sanders 46 yard catch on 3rd and 16 with less than a minute to go against the Rams week 16, and George Kittle's 39 yard conversion on 4th and 2 against the Saints week 14 were all huge plays. However, the 4th and goal stop by Dre Greenlaw last night against the Seahawks has to be our play of the year. Incredible recognition and tackle and the stakes were sky high.
